QFZ-II Paint Film Adhesion Tester

It is suitable for the determination of the adhesion of the paint film. The fastness of the paint film to the substrate is the adhesion.

The degree of adhesion of the coating film to the substrate is evaluated according to the integrity of the coating film within the scratch range of the circular rolling line, expressed in grades.

Standards

GB/T 1720 Determination of paint film adhesion

This instrument is a desktop manual and is divided into five parts.

1. The hand transmission part is due to the wheel, the toothed belt, and the toothed pulley. Composed of helical gear transmission and drawing head, when the hand wheel is turned, the worktable moves left and right, and the needle is drawing a circle at the same time.

2. The description header part is composed of the following two components;

a. The double-headed square screw is used to adjust the machine head up and down.

b. It is composed of a head jacket and an eccentric head core and can be rotated to adjust the drawing diameter.

3. The workbench part is connected with a lead screw with a movable half nut at one end to drive the workbench to move back and forth. There are four nuts and two pressure plates on the workbench for pressing and releasing the test piece.

4. The base part is used to support the workbench and the tracing head, etc.

Instructions

1. Prepare templates as required.

2. It is better to check the steel needle and replace it with a new steel needle at the beginning of use (the needle tip is about 3 mm away from the work surface).

3. Adjust the eccentric position of the needle point according to the required drawing diameter, and then tighten it with screws.

4. Install the prepared model with the painted side up on the workbench and press it tightly with a pressure plate.

5. Add weights on the weight pan as required.

6. Lift the movable half nut to move the table to the outer end, then lower the movable half nut.

7. Oscillate the plunger to bring the needle tip into contact with the membrane surface.

8. Shake the handwheel, the steel needle will draw a spiral pattern on the sample plate, and the adhesion of the coating film can be judged according to the pattern.

9. Take out the sample, use a paintbrush to remove the paint film on the scratches, check the scratches with a four times magnifying glass and grade them.

Take the upper side of the scratches on the model as the target of inspection, and mark seven parts such as 1, 2, 3, 4, 5, 6, and 7 in sequence. Correspondingly divided into seven levels. Check the completeness of the paint film of each part in order. If more than 70% of the lattice of a certain part is intact, the part is considered to be intact, otherwise it should be considered damaged. For example, if the paint film of part 1 is intact and the adhesion is very good, it is rated as the first grade; if the paint film of part 1 is damaged and the part 2 is intact, the adhesion is next, and it is rated as the second grade. And so on, grade seven is the worst adhesion.

    The result is subject to the same level of at least two samples.
